About the job
Opportunity:
Our brand design team is responsible for creating, developing, and producing innovative visual communication strategies that support our products across multiple touchpoints. Within this team, the Playbook Design function plays a vital role in crafting the consumer experience by translating product intentions, assembly steps, and brand design into clear, attractive, and intuitive manuals and educational materials. We are currently seeking an energetic, passionate, creative individual with a keen eye for detail who can manage moderately complex projects in designing instruction guides for an associate designer role. Reporting to the packaging manager, this position involves close collaboration with cross-functional partners to support the development and implementation of high-quality user guides.
Your Impact:
- Design and develop instruction manuals that clearly communicate assembly steps, product features, and product intent.
- Collaborate with product design, marketing, brand design teams, and cross-functional partners to enhance the overall consumer experience.
- Translate technical requirements and product specifications into clear, intuitive, and visually appealing instructions.
- Prepare and present instruction booklet documents for validation and approval.
- Manage timelines and ensure adherence to production milestones with precision and consistency.
- Adapt to new technologies, trends, and advancements in graphic design.
